Output 3ac842083ec52cf287450b543e153574bdb23a30208a9968417827def61c8aba:0

value
1069500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ba20d050f138d5b449f76a0e83c2a1481213534 OP_EQUALVERIFY OP_CHECKSIG
address
13X7NftRQvWPwH4SKqJxRH9bi4iLmxh4Gm
transaction
3ac842083ec52cf287450b543e153574bdb23a30208a9968417827def61c8aba
spent
true